Граф коммитов

46 Коммитов

Автор SHA1 Сообщение Дата
andre.maestas 0078d23b90 Added ability to get stereo mode from custom sstring field
workaround for perf framework always reporting multipass
2022-06-14 17:18:33 -07:00
andre.maestas 052c11d512 Merge branch 'JsonParserUpdate' of github.cds.internal.unity3d.com:unity/PerformanceBenchmarkReporter into JsonParserUpdate 2022-06-14 16:11:53 -07:00
Andre Maestas e062f85a4f Fixed Perf Result Calculation 2022-03-28 16:42:13 -07:00
andre.maestas c09f4a6c30 Default Aggregation Type To Medium if not specified 2022-03-25 15:24:58 -07:00
andre.maestas 80afdbce6f Added Threshold to V2 Data Format Parsing
Fixed Standard Deviation in Pass Fail Calculation
2022-03-25 10:57:45 -07:00
Andre Maestas 8f28284bfc Added Logging for Progresed Tests
Fixed Tests on Json side
Added Stndard deveation to threshold calculation
2022-03-23 16:47:17 -07:00
andre.maestas 572aee041d Removed PerformanceBenchmarkTests
Added PerformanceBenchmarkTestsJson
Added PerformanceBenchmarkTestsXML
Added TestData files
Fixed baseline files not being read when path is a directory
2022-03-17 00:40:58 -07:00
andre.maestas 226f1b471f Added error when passing invalid val for Data Version 2022-03-11 18:28:35 -08:00
andre.maestas 9e45f6c99c Added method to parse data version from commandline
Implemented parsing of V2 data format
Updated IParser interface to pass down Data Version
2022-03-11 17:22:28 -08:00
Andre Maestas 1f3d75c58d Added Spaces To Logging
Added New Option To Specify Data Version
2022-03-11 15:23:26 -08:00
Andre Maestas 34e0dca470 Fixed Compile Errors in Tests 2022-03-09 12:12:31 -08:00
andre.maestas ce4224a5cb Added FileTypeCmdLine Option
Fixed Issue Where PerfData didnt parse due to not being in array like AllPerfData file
Added Parsing for Filetype cmd line to enum
Added additional logging
2022-03-02 09:06:55 -08:00
andre.maestas 902adb6f04 Added ESupportedFileType
Changed Core Classes to be file type agnostic
Added new option to set resuilts and baseline file type
2022-02-18 15:56:01 -08:00
andre.maestas b7ac12cde3 Added Json Parser
Added IParser Interface
Made Parsers use IParser interface
2022-02-18 15:39:31 -08:00
andre.maestas 73c86c0d6f Updated Perf Data Classes to match new format 2022-02-18 15:35:36 -08:00
Sean Stolberg 0aaef2647e Update .NET core version to LTS 3.1 and update Chart.js bundle 2021-05-17 15:13:53 -07:00
Sean Stolberg d0ff60e5fd update chartjs version 2020-06-29 16:39:18 -07:00
Sean Stolberg a03781e5c7 saving WIP 2020-06-29 16:38:58 -07:00
Gintautas Skersys e00951c081 Merge pull request #4 from unity/change-date-type
Fix for date format from epoch unix s to ms
2020-05-14 16:06:42 +03:00
gintas 7875c0d392 Fix for date format from epoch unix s to ms 2020-05-14 15:31:17 +03:00
Sean Stolberg 9fe50428a8 update metadata, fix show failed tests only bug
(cherry picked from commit c1dd134394ff3f950ce97ed4ccd363e584e13c54)
2020-05-06 14:13:02 -07:00
Sean Stolberg afb22f8821 Update readme
small change to force sync
2020-04-13 12:08:37 -07:00
Sean Stolberg 95bbad6fcb Xr metadata extraction (#3)
Update metadata processor to extract xr specific metadata
2020-04-13 12:02:57 -07:00
Sean Stolberg d6722faec7 Merge pull request #2 from unity/upgrade-core3
Upgrade core3
2020-02-13 09:54:36 -08:00
Sean Stolberg 39462bb625 Merge pull request #1 from unity/new-data-format
Add support for 2.x package data format
2020-02-13 09:52:41 -08:00
Gintautas Skersys 459d39a878 Upgrade to core 3.0 2020-02-11 16:50:25 +02:00
Gintautas Skersys cd1de7f82f Add support for 2.x package data format 2020-02-11 16:31:41 +02:00
Sean Stolberg 27f829d27e Merge branch 'Cleanup_refactor' into '2018.2'
Cleanup refactor

See merge request seans/PerformanceBenchmarkReporter!2
2018-09-07 13:16:14 +00:00
Sean Stolberg 00b3602028 Cleanup refactor 2018-09-07 13:16:14 +00:00
Sean Stolberg 7f8c08ce89 Testing on OSX. Update path handling to be more cross-platform. 2018-08-26 20:37:55 -07:00
Sean Stolberg 30a10907b1 small updates 2018-08-24 12:40:56 -07:00
Sean Stolberg 100de9f870 Updates to show "None" for XR settings when VR disabled 2018-08-23 23:32:00 -07:00
Sean Stolberg 2079762bf4 Only allow use of a single baseline result file. Update help output. 2018-08-23 08:36:45 -07:00
Sean Stolberg 35b625de6a Handle case where we want to exclude all field names in config so that the entire section is not show, and we don't look for mismatches on excluded field names. Update and create a few images. 2018-08-22 21:43:18 -07:00
Sean Stolberg 1d18dc3e5e Removing sigfig option; not necessary enough to justify the work to explain and maintain. Update formatting in tool tip to use line breaks, add a Regression type message in tooltip so it's clear which ones are (on top of the red color). Add a help icon with link to GitHub wiki 2018-08-21 22:22:09 -07:00
Sean Stolberg 5ccdb266a6 For mismatched confgs, show values that are not misatched in black, css and c# cleanup. 2018-08-20 21:31:37 -07:00
Sean Stolberg 9cb7db7445 Add warning indicator to Show Test Config button, add sample count to chart mouse over 2018-08-20 18:49:21 -07:00
Sean Stolberg e020355238 Add better check for EnabledXrTargets metadata validation; simplify reportwriter logic when handling IEnumberable types 2018-08-20 10:15:57 -07:00
Sean Stolberg ca21363f1a Display test environment configs that are different for result files in a table. Fix js issue with Show Config button.Update .css to use a more fluid layout for test configs that can accomodate different sized strings. 2018-08-20 09:01:30 -07:00
Sean Stolberg 3a36bf7621 add unit tests for Extension Methods, update .css, roll up metadata validation results to the Test Environment Config sections. Update screenshot of web page for wiki. 2018-08-17 13:29:08 -07:00
Sean Stolberg 060832ec9a Update readme with link to wiki 2018-08-15 02:56:35 -07:00
Sean Stolberg 1474a019a3 crop photo 2018-08-14 23:34:25 -07:00
Sean Stolberg 7b773cbbe6 Add report screenshot 2018-08-14 23:30:20 -07:00
Sean Stolberg d4e002e25b update doc 2018-08-14 14:46:10 -07:00
Sean Stolberg 90a589eb31 Clone repo from GitLab 2018-08-14 11:32:48 -07:00
Sean Stolberg 9ca92eed59
Initial commit 2018-08-14 02:54:12 -07:00